Output e52ced5588f1c17036cdec76b55477e710583424c51e889cd5818628766187b7:93

value
29846
script pubkey
OP_0 OP_PUSHBYTES_20 308b7d53ac1289e2581050534550340668904a29
address
bc1qxz9h65avz2y7ykqs2pf525p5qe5fqj3f7yk244
transaction
e52ced5588f1c17036cdec76b55477e710583424c51e889cd5818628766187b7
confirmations
56718
spent
true